Went to this restaurant recommended by my friends. While waiting for seats, there are complimentary drinks and snacks outside.
Each dishes is presented very elegant. What surprised me the most is how large the oyster is. The oyster is almost the size of my palm. The oyster is fresh and juicy.
The sashimi was also great too. The salmon and tuna slices are very thick. It is equivalent to 2 piece of the usual slices in other restaurant.
The Chirashi Don consists of 3 slices of Salmon (sake), Tuna (maguro), Yellowtail (hamachi) respectively, Prawn (ebi), Crabstick (kani) and Flying fish roe (tobiko).
It’s pretty fresh and has a good thickness. However, I’d wish they included some hotate and mekajiki into this bowl. The rice was quite little in proportion to the sashimi.
The Chawanmushi was well done too. Topped with Ikura, it gave the steamed egg extra flavor when it burst in your mouth.
